From: Regulation of phenylacetic acid degradation genes of Burkholderia cenocepacia K56-2
Strain or plasmid | Features | Reference or source |
---|---|---|
B. cenocepacia strains | Â | Â |
K56-2 (LMG18863) | ET12 clone related to J2315, CF clinical isolate | [43] |
JNRH1 | K56-2BCAL0210::pJH9, Tpr | This study |
E. coli strains | Â | Â |
DH5α | F-, ϕ 80 lac ZΔM15 endA1 recA1 hsdR 17(rK-mK+)supE 44 thi- 1 ΔgyrA 96 (ΔlacZYA-arg F)U169 relA 1 | Invitrogen |
SY327 | araD Δ(lac pro) argE (Am) recA 56 Rifr nalA λ pir | [40] |
Plasmids | Â | Â |
pGPΩTp | ori r6K, ΩTpr mob+ | [27] |
pRK2013 | oricolE1, RK2 derivative, Kmr mob+ tra+ | [42] |
pJH9 | pGPΩTp, internal fragment from BCAL0210 | This study |
pJH1 | pap20, eGFP | [9] |
pJH2 | pJH1, eGFP replaced promoter with multiple cloning site | This study |
pJH5 | pJH2, BCAL0211 promoter region (P BCAL0211 ) | This study |
pJH6 | pJH2, paaZ promoter region (P paaZ ) | This study |
pJH7 | pJH2, paaA promoter region (P paaA ) | This study |
pJH8 | pJH2 paaH promoter region (P paaH ) | This study |
pJH10 | pJH7, ACCGACCGGTCGGT → TAGATGTATCTCAG | This study |
pJH11 | pJH7, ACCGACCGGTCGGT → TAGATGTGGTCGGT | This study |
pJH12 | pJH7, ACCGACCGGTCGGT → ACCGACCATCTCAG | This study |
